The Simple Model Viewer is a user-friendly ICE Control Panel application designed for viewing simple 3D models within an immersive Igloo Environment. With an easy drag-and-drop setup, it allows users to navigate through 3D models from different angles.
Supported File Types
GLTF / GLB: Vastly preferred and most compatible.
OBJ: Optionally with associated MTL files.
IFC: Supported but might require additional settings.
STL: Compatible with standard configurations.
Usage Instructions
Loading the Model
Drag & Drop: Drag the desired 3D model file from the supported file types onto the loader page.
Select: Click on the model in the sidebar to select it. The selected model will be loaded across all other pages.
Interacting with the Model
Control Panel: Utilise the functions available on the loader page to interact with the model.
Real-time Reflection: Changes made through the loader page will be reflected across other endpoints.
Navigation Controls
Move Around: Use the
W
,A
,S
,D
keys.Move Up & Down: Use the
Q
andE
keys.
Using SketchFab as a Resource for 3D Models
SketchFab is an online platform with a wide variety of 3D models. You can browse, purchase, or download free models that suit your needs.
Downloading Models from SketchFab:
Find a Model: Browse through SketchFab's extensive library and select a model that is compatible with the Simple Model Viewer's supported file types.
Download: If the model is available for download (free or purchased), click the 'Download' button on the model's page.
Choose a Format: Most models on Sketchfab are available to download using the GLTF format, where available use this.
Extract if Necessary: Some models may download in a compressed file format. Extract the files using a program like WinRAR or 7-Zip.
Adding a Downloaded Model to Simple Model Viewer:
Navigate to Loader Page: Open the Simple Model Viewer and navigate to the loader page.
Drag & Drop: Drag the downloaded model file onto the loader page.
Select & View: Click on the model in the sidebar to select and view it in the Igloo Environment.
Advanced Configuration
Endpoints
Interact with the Simple Model Viewer through the following endpoints:
model-viewer/control/
: Access the control panel interface for in-depth customization.model-viewer/orbit
: Render a single frame orbit view, particularly the 'front' camera of the cubemap.model-viewer/iglooview/
: A dedicated cubemap viewer for Igloo Environment.